George R.R. Martin jokes his minions are “threatening to kill” him if he veers off of The Winds of Winter
One of today’s most well-known authors is Game of Thrones‘ George R. R. Martin. Because he incorporates aspects of both reality and imagination, his works have a distinct character. That is why fans have been waiting for the next book in the series, The Winds of Winter, for over a decade. Martin has time and time again assured fans that he is indeed working on the novel. This time, his own minions are making sure he stays on track.
George R. R. Martin’s ‘minions’ are keeping him in check
Martin is infamous for his slow writing speed. However, his biggest and closest fans, the minions – comprising Lenore, Elias, Sid, Raya, Andrea, Amy and Sarah – are making sure he’s working on the novel every day. He revealed on the Game of Owns podcast that his minions are “cracking whips” to make sure he stays on task. He says, “She has been threatening to kill me if I take on another project.”
George R. R. Martin assures fans he’s still writing The Winds of Winter
There’s a reason why George R. R. Martin is never a showrunner on a Game of Thrones show – he is too busy writing Winds of Winter. He said,

“There’s part of me that would love to be actually writing and running all of these shows…but I can’t! You may not know this, but there’s this book that I’m writing…it’s a little late, but I gotta keep working on it and finishing it!”
